Top Birds at South Ferry incl. Staten I. + Gov. I. Ferry Terminals in September
relative to other locations within 25 miles of 40.781243, -73.966507

based on 63 checklists

This page shows the probability of a species appearing on a checklist at South Ferry incl. Staten I. + Gov. I. Ferry Terminals in September. The difference in probability relative to other nearby locations is also shown, to highlight which birds are particularly likely to be found (or not found) at this specific location.
